  • With GAP they pay into your bank account - I had no idea they were in Australia until today - I thought they were somewhere in Europe. I've never had a problem with payment, they pay in British pounds, but I've only been with them for about 4 months. Try BARE - they are in Europe and pay in euros but it also goes straight into your bank account and gets converted into sterling.
